Isooctane is a standard for gasoline octane rating. A sample weighing .5992 g was found to contain .5040 g of carbon and .09515 g of hydrogen. Its molecular mass is 114. Write the empirical and molecular formulas of isooctane (arranging the symbols in order CxHy).

Give the enthalpies of the reaction P4 (s) + 3O2(g)-->P4O6(s) Delta H= -1640.1 kJ. P4 (s) + 5O2 (g)--->P4O10 (s) Delta H= -2940.1 kJ Calculate the enthalpy change for reaction: P4O6(s) + 2O2 (g)--->P4O10(s)
